Centralization in Proof-of-Stake Blockchains: A Game-Theoretic Analysis of Bootstrapping Protocols

2404.09627

YC

0

Reddit

0

Published 4/16/2024 by Varul Srivastava, Sankarshan Damle, Sujit Gujar
Centralization in Proof-of-Stake Blockchains: A Game-Theoretic Analysis of Bootstrapping Protocols

Abstract

Proof-of-stake (PoS) has emerged as a natural alternative to the resource-intensive Proof-of-Work (PoW) blockchain, as was recently seen with the Ethereum Merge. PoS-based blockchains require an initial stake distribution among the participants. Typically, this initial stake distribution is called bootstrapping. This paper argues that existing bootstrapping protocols are prone to centralization. To address centralization due to bootstrapping, we propose a novel game $Gamma_textsf{bootstrap}$. Next, we define three conditions: (i) Individual Rationality (IR), (ii) Incentive Compatibility (IC), and (iii) $(tau,delta,epsilon)-$ Decentralization that an emph{ideal} bootstrapping protocol must satisfy. $(tau,delta,epsilon)$ are certain parameters to quantify decentralization. Towards this, we propose a novel centralization metric, C-NORM, to measure centralization in a PoS System. We define a centralization game -- $Gamma_textsf{cent}$, to analyze the efficacy of centralization metrics. We show that C-NORM effectively captures centralization in the presence of strategic players capable of launching Sybil attacks. With C-NORM, we analyze popular bootstrapping protocols such as Airdrop and Proof-of-Burn (PoB) and prove that they do not satisfy IC and IR, respectively. Motivated by the Ethereum Merge, we study W2SB (a PoW-based bootstrapping protocol) and prove it is ideal. In addition, we conduct synthetic simulations to empirically validate that W2SB bootstrapped PoS is decentralized.

Create account to get full access

or

If you already have an account, we'll log you in

Overview

  • This paper analyzes the centralization risks in proof-of-stake blockchain protocols during the bootstrapping phase.
  • The authors propose a game-theoretic model to quantify the degree of centralization and evaluate different bootstrapping protocols.
  • The findings suggest that popular bootstrapping approaches can lead to significant centralization, highlighting the need for more decentralized designs.

Plain English Explanation

Blockchains are decentralized digital ledgers that record transactions without a central authority. Proof-of-stake (PoS) is a popular consensus mechanism used by many blockchains, where participants "stake" their cryptocurrency to validate transactions and earn rewards.

However, the initial bootstrapping phase of PoS blockchains can be a source of centralization risk. During this phase, early participants may have an outsized influence, potentially leading to a concentration of power. This paper explores this issue using game theory, a mathematical framework for studying strategic decision-making.

The authors develop a model to quantify the degree of centralization in PoS blockchain bootstrapping. They evaluate different bootstrapping protocols, including common approaches like token distribution and early staking rewards. The analysis suggests that these protocols can indeed result in significant centralization, undermining the decentralized principles of blockchain technology.

The findings highlight the need for more decentralized bootstrapping designs to ensure the long-term sustainability and fairness of PoS blockchain ecosystems. This research provides valuable insights for blockchain developers and policymakers interested in fostering truly decentralized and equitable blockchain networks.

Technical Explanation

The paper presents a game-theoretic analysis of centralization risks in proof-of-stake (PoS) blockchain bootstrapping protocols. The authors propose a model that captures the strategic decision-making of participants during the bootstrapping phase, where the initial distribution of stake and rewards can have a significant impact on the eventual concentration of power.

The model considers a PoS blockchain with a finite number of participants, each with an initial stake. Participants can choose to stake their tokens or withhold them, based on the expected rewards and the perceived centralization risk. The authors analyze the equilibrium outcomes of this game, which reflect the degree of centralization in the network.

The paper evaluates several common bootstrapping protocols, including token distribution and early staking rewards. The analysis shows that these protocols can lead to significant centralization, as early participants with larger initial stakes have a strong incentive to participate and further consolidate their power.

The technical insights from this research highlight the need for more decentralized bootstrapping designs to ensure the long-term sustainability and fairness of PoS blockchain networks. The findings can inform the development of new protocols and the evaluation of existing ones, contributing to the ongoing efforts to build truly decentralized blockchain systems.

Critical Analysis

The paper provides a robust game-theoretic framework for analyzing centralization risks in PoS blockchain bootstrapping protocols. By modeling the strategic behavior of participants, the authors are able to quantify the degree of centralization that can arise from different bootstrapping approaches.

One potential limitation of the study is the assumption of a finite number of participants. In reality, PoS blockchains may attract a large and dynamic pool of participants over time, which could influence the centralization dynamics. Additionally, the model does not consider the potential impact of external factors, such as regulatory changes or technological advancements, which could affect the incentives and behavior of participants.

Further research could explore the sensitivity of the model's predictions to these additional factors, as well as investigate alternative bootstrapping protocols that might be more resistant to centralization. Exploring the tradeoffs between decentralization, scalability, and security in the context of PoS blockchain design would also be a valuable direction for future work.

Conclusion

This paper's game-theoretic analysis of PoS blockchain bootstrapping protocols highlights the significant centralization risks inherent in popular approaches like token distribution and early staking rewards. The findings underscore the need for more decentralized bootstrapping designs to ensure the long-term sustainability and fairness of PoS blockchain ecosystems.

The insights provided by this research can inform the development of new blockchain protocols and the evaluation of existing ones, contributing to the ongoing efforts to build truly decentralized and equitable blockchain networks. As the adoption of PoS blockchains continues to grow, addressing the centralization challenges identified in this paper will be crucial for realizing the full potential of this technology.



This summary was produced with help from an AI and may contain inaccuracies - check out the links to read the original source documents!

Related Papers

How Does Stake Distribution Influence Consensus? Analyzing Blockchain Decentralization

How Does Stake Distribution Influence Consensus? Analyzing Blockchain Decentralization

Shashank Motepalli, Hans-Arno Jacobsen

YC

0

Reddit

0

In the PoS blockchain landscape, the challenge of achieving full decentralization is often hindered by a disproportionate concentration of staked tokens among a few validators. This study analyses this challenge by first formalizing decentralization metrics for weighted consensus mechanisms. An empirical analysis across ten permissionless blockchains uncovers significant weight concentration among validators, underscoring the need for an equitable approach. To counter this, we introduce the Square Root Stake Weight (SRSW) model, which effectively recalibrates staking weight distribution. Our examination of the SRSW model demonstrates notable improvements in the decentralization metrics: the Gini index improves by 37.16% on average, while Nakamoto coefficients for liveness and safety see mean enhancements of 101.04% and 80.09%, respectively. This research is a pivotal step toward a more fair and equitable distribution of staking weight, advancing the decentralization in blockchain consensus mechanisms.

Read more

5/21/2024

Proof-of-Learning with Incentive Security

Proof-of-Learning with Incentive Security

Zishuo Zhao, Zhixuan Fang, Xuechao Wang, Xi Chen, Yuan Zhou

YC

0

Reddit

0

Most concurrent blockchain systems rely heavily on the Proof-of-Work (PoW) or Proof-of-Stake (PoS) mechanisms for decentralized consensus and security assurance. However, the substantial energy expenditure stemming from computationally intensive yet meaningless tasks has raised considerable concerns surrounding traditional PoW approaches, The PoS mechanism, while free of energy consumption, is subject to security and economic issues. Addressing these issues, the paradigm of Proof-of-Useful-Work (PoUW) seeks to employ challenges of practical significance as PoW, thereby imbuing energy consumption with tangible value. While previous efforts in Proof of Learning (PoL) explored the utilization of deep learning model training SGD tasks as PoUW challenges, recent research has revealed its vulnerabilities to adversarial attacks and the theoretical hardness in crafting a byzantine-secure PoL mechanism. In this paper, we introduce the concept of incentive-security that incentivizes rational provers to behave honestly for their best interest, bypassing the existing hardness to design a PoL mechanism with computational efficiency, a provable incentive-security guarantee and controllable difficulty. Particularly, our work is secure against two attacks to the recent work of Jia et al. [2021], and also improves the computational overhead from $Theta(1)$ to $O(frac{log E}{E})$. Furthermore, while most recent research assumes trusted problem providers and verifiers, our design also guarantees frontend incentive-security even when problem providers are untrusted, and verifier incentive-security that bypasses the Verifier's Dilemma. By incorporating ML training into blockchain consensus mechanisms with provable guarantees, our research not only proposes an eco-friendly solution to blockchain systems, but also provides a proposal for a completely decentralized computing power market in the new AI age.

Read more

6/6/2024

A Dual-functional Blockchain Framework for Solving Distributed Optimization

A Dual-functional Blockchain Framework for Solving Distributed Optimization

Weihang Cao, Xintong Ling, Jiaheng Wang, Xiqi Gao, Zhi Ding

YC

0

Reddit

0

Proof of Work (PoW) has been extensively utilized as the foundation of blockchain's security, consistency, and tamper-resistance. However, long has it been criticized for its tremendous and inefficient utilization of computational power and energy. In this work, we design a dual-functional blockchain framework that uses solving optimization problems to reach consensus as an alternative to PoW, channeling wasted resources into useful work. We model and analyze our framework by developing discrete Markov chains, and derive the security conditions to ensure that selfish miners behave honestly. Based on the security conditions, we derive a lower bound for the security overhead and analyze the trade-off between useful work efficiency and PoW safeguard. We further dive deep into the reward function design for the proposed dual-functional blockchain and provide practical design guidelines for reward functions assuming concavity and linearity respectively. Finally, simulation results are presented to validate and illustrate our analytical results.

Read more

5/30/2024

Fuzzychain: An Equitable Consensus Mechanism for Blockchain Networks

Fuzzychain: An Equitable Consensus Mechanism for Blockchain Networks

Bruno Ramos-Cruz, Javier Andreu-P'erez, Francisco J. Quesada, Luis Mart'inez

YC

0

Reddit

0

Blockchain technology has become a trusted method for establishing secure and transparent transactions through a distributed, encrypted network. The operation of blockchain is governed by consensus algorithms, among which Proof of Stake (PoS) is popular yet has its drawbacks, notably the potential for centralising power in nodes with larger stakes or higher rewards. Fuzzychain, our proposed solution, introduces the use of fuzzy sets to define stake semantics, promoting decentralised and distributed processing control. This system selects validators based on their degree of membership to the stake fuzzy sets rather than just the size of their stakes. As a pioneer proposal in applying fuzzy sets to blockchain, Fuzzychain aims to rectify PoS's limitations. Our results indicate that Fuzzychain not only matches PoS in functionality but also ensures a fairer distribution of stakes among validators, leading to more inclusive validator selection and a better-distributed network.

Read more

6/3/2024